The M3 and M3T have the same output and runtime specs. The M3T has a TurboHead bezel (that's the "T" in the model number). The TurboHead bezel concentrates the light into a tighter beam for longer range illumination.Please excuse my ignorance here but could somebody kindly please explain the difference between the M3L and the M3TL as they appear different but have the same specs?
